Why Payroll Phishing Attacks Could Cost You Big

Payroll departments are a prime target because they hold the keys to sensitive employee data and financial information. Attackers craft convincing emails that mimic internal messages, hoping to trick even vigilant employees into revealing login credentials or transferring funds. The consequences can be devastating—ranging from data breaches to significant financial losses. Early on, I made the mistake of trusting an email that looked legitimate, which underscored how easy it is to fall victim if you’re not vigilant. According to the FBI’s Internet Crime Complaint Center, Business Email Compromise schemes—often involving payroll impersonations—caused over $1.7 billion in losses in 2022 alone. Implement Email Filtering and Security Protocols

Use advanced spam filters and email authentication protocols such as SPF, DKIM, and DMARC to prevent malicious emails from reaching inboxes. When I set up these filters in our company’s email system, I noticed a significant decline in phishing emails slipping through. These protocols validate the sender’s authenticity, acting like a bouncer at a club, only allowing legitimate visitors. Establish Clear Verification Processes for Payroll Requests

Create a protocol where any change in payroll details is verified through a secondary channel—such as a direct phone call or face-to-face confirmation. I learned this lesson the hard way when an urgent email request for bank info was sent, and a quick call confirmed it was a scam. Think of it like confirming a large purchase in person; a quick verification seals the deal. Make sure all team members are aware of this process and trust only verified communication before making any changes.

Develop a Response Plan for Potential Breaches

Prepare a clear action plan should you suspect a phishing attempt or data breach. This plan should outline steps for isolating affected systems, notifying authorities, and informing clients or employees. During a previous incident, having a script ready and a designated team member to contact law enforcement expedited our response, minimizing damage. Think of this as a fire drill—preparing today prevents chaos tomorrow. Regular drills and updates to your plan ensure everyone knows their role, reducing panic and confusion during real events.
